Figlet is a simple command line utility for creating ascii text banners or large letters out of ordinary text, whereas toilet a sub command under figlet is a command line utility for creating colorful large characters from ordinary text. The ascii protocol is a queryresponse or a question and answer communication protocol in which a host pc uses ascii characters to send commands to a device and then receives responses back from that device.
